Campbellton is a city in Restigouche, New Brunswick, Canada. It is classified as a large city. Campbellton is located at 47.9993°N, 66.6835°W.
Campbellton, nestled along the southern reaches of the Restigouche River estuary, benefits from a geography shaped by the meeting of water and land, where the rolling hills of New Brunswick begin to ascend towards the more rugged interior. It lies 19.5 km west of Bois-Joli, NB (from Bois-Joli, NB: bearing 264°T), and is situated 3.0 km east-north-east of Atholville. This strategic location has historically been a crossroads, first for Indigenous peoples and later for European settlers drawn by the promise of abundant timber and the rich fishing grounds of the river. The economy of Campbellton has long been tied to these natural resources, with forestry and pulp and paper mills forming the backbone of its industrial past, and the river itself continuing to be a vital artery for transportation and recreation.
